Welcome! Santa Barbara City College is an exciting and innovative center of learning
located on the Central Coast of California, on a bluff overlooking the Pacific Ocean.
As our community’s college, we offer excellent educational opportunities, degrees
and certificates. Strengthened by the Santa Barbara City College Foundation’s Promise,
our commitment to providing affordable higher education is matched by our commitment
to an inclusive, welcoming learning environment. You’ll feel right at home here.
It’s our mission at Santa Barbara City College to provide a diverse learning environment and opportunities for students to enrich their lives, advance their careers, complete certificates, earn associate degrees, and transfer to four-year institutions. The College is committed to fostering an equitable, inclusive, respectful, participatory, and supportive community dedicated to the success of every student. The Office of Educational Programs is responsible for providing the student programs and services designed to fulfill this mission. As you will discover from exploring our vast array of programs and services, our dedicated faculty, staff, and administrators work tirelessly to help students achieve excellence in all aspects of academic life.
